首页 / 生活杂谈 / autsoar(Autsoar 高效自动化软件设计的未来)

autsoar(Autsoar 高效自动化软件设计的未来)

2024-08-07生活杂谈阅读 1262

Autsoar: 高效自动化软件设计的未来

介绍

随着科技的发展,软件已经成为现代社会的核心部分,涵盖了从计算机操作系统和工具到传感器网络和机器学习算法等所有领域。然而,软件开发仍然是一项既耗时又困难的任务,尤其是对于复杂的系统来说。为了解决这些挑战,Autsoar项目致力于提供一个可重复、高效且自动化的软件设计流程。

Autsoar是什么

Autsoar是一个飞行控制系统的自动化软件设计工具,包括自动代码生成、模块化设计、仿真测试和优化等多种功能。它的设计理念是使用模型驱动架构,将系统设计分解为多个模块,每个模块分别从输入数据生成输出数据。这使得Autsoar具有高度的可扩展性和复用性,同时也为系统的测试和维护提供了方便。

Autsoar的特点和优势

1. 自动化代码生成:Autsoar通过自动生成代码来提高软件开发的速度和质量。开发人员只需要使用标准化的规范,就可以快速生成高效且可靠的代码。 2. 模块化设计:Autsoar将系统的设计分解为多个模块,每个模块都具有明确的输入和输出。这种设计方式有利于代码的重复使用和测试。 3. 仿真测试:Autsoar提供仿真测试工具,可以帮助开发者在软件发布之前测试系统的功能和性能。 4. 优化:Autsoar具有优化功能,可以帮助开发者在系统设计过程中进行优化,以提高系统的性能和可靠性。 Autsoar的另一个优势是可以适用于各种不同类型的系统,不仅限于飞行控制系统。由于Autsoar采用的是模型驱动的设计方法,因此可以根据具体应用场景来设计模型,并自动生成代码。这使得Autsoar可以在广泛的行业和领域中发挥作用,例如智能家居、医疗设备、机器人等。 在未来,我们有理由相信,Autsoar将成为高效自动化软件设计的标准工具。它将在改善软件开发的速度和质量、提高系统性能和可靠性等方面发挥重要作用,为我们的生活带来更多的便利和创新。
全部评论(0
评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

相关推荐